Description

A kind of radioactive isotope transporting equipment
Technical field
The present invention relates to isotope field more particularly to a kind of radioactive isotope transporting equipments.

Specific embodiment
The present invention is further elaborated in the following with reference to the drawings and specific embodiments.
As shown in Figs 1-4, a kind of radioactive isotope transporting equipment, including bottom plate 5, water tank 4, insulated tank 3, outer barrel 11, Interior bucket 10,5 bottom of bottom plate are equipped with the universal wheel 1 of screw installation, and universal wheel has foot brake, and water tank 4 and insulated tank 3 are logical It crosses bolt to be fixed on bottom plate 5, the outer surface of insulated tank 3 is wound with water pipe 2, the water inlet and the immersible pump in water tank 4 of water pipe 2 Connection, immersible pump have battery to be powered, and battery is mountable on the outside of water tank, and the water outlet of water pipe 2 is connected to water tank 4, It is welded with bracket 12 in the insulated tank 3, heat-barrier material is smeared on the inside of insulated tank, it is thin that polyimides of aluminizing can be selected in heat-barrier material Film, the surface of insulated tank are bonded with thermometer, and bracket 12 is connect with the engaging lug of 11 two sides of outer barrel, and 11 bottom of outer barrel is welded with bullet Spring 7, spring can be used the design of pagoda spring, interior bucket 10 are equipped in said tub 11, is filled out in the gap between outer barrel 11 and interior bucket 10 Lead screen layer 6 is filled, partition 9 is welded in the interior bucket 10, card slot 8 is offered on partition 9, isotope storage is placed in card slot Pipe, the inner adhesion of card slot 8 have air bag 13, and air bag 13 is equipped with gas tube, and gas-pressurized is infused by gas tube into air bag 13 Enter, and gas tube is equipped with valve, the insulated tank 3, outer barrel 11, interior bucket 10 top be all made of the cover of threaded connection and set Meter.
Working principle of the present invention: radioactive isotope pipe is placed on partition 9 in card slot 8, by filling after the completion of placing Tracheae injects gas into air bag 13, and air bag 13 can not only reinforce radioactive isotope pipe, while to the same position of radioactivity Plain pipe plays buffer function, after the completion of placement, the cover of interior bucket 10 and outer barrel 11 is tightened, the lead between interior bucket 10 and outer barrel 11 Shielded layer can reduce radioactivity, and it is same to the radioactivity in interior bucket 10 that the bracket 12 and spring 7 connecting with outer barrel 11 reduce vibration The influence of position element, when ambient temperature is higher, opening the immersible pump in water tank 4 makes the water in water tank 4 by water pipe 2 to insulated tank 3 carry out forced heat radiation.
